The crystal structure of piperazinediium hexa­aqua­zinc(II) bis­(sulfate), (C4H12N2)[Zn(H2O)6](SO4)2, is built from isolated [Zn(H2O)6]2+, SO42- and C4H12N22+ ions linked together by a hydrogen-bonding network. The title compound exhibits strong analogies with some double aluminium sulfates, also known as Tutton's salts.
